Has anyone found any miniatures they really like as Witch Elves with the 2nd Ed Dark Elf team? I was finally successful in acquiring a team and want to build one up as a gift for my brother, but I'm at a bit of a loss as to what to use for the Witches.

Since the old 2nd Ed Dark Elves are so small, the modern era Witch Elves look far too large in comparison, I think, so matching that original scale is a bit trickier. I'd prefer to use metal miniatures, since for whatever odd reason I hate mixing plastics and metals on the same team.

OOP WHFB Witch Elves are perfect, size and style. I just used hand swaps and they fit in perfectly. Look for the Marauder Miniatures era, they work nicely.

I had the same issue finding witches for my dark elf team. I'm normally OCD level conservative in my desire to use old skool models for my teams but I really don't like the old WHFB witch elves. To me, a witch elf should be beautiful, albeit deadly. The old Marauder witch elves have square faces and look like drags - in my humble opinion...

So, I broke all my holy principles and use GW's new witch elves for my 2nd ed. team. :oops:
http://www.games-workshop.com/gws/catal ... od1610034a

They are not too big - approx. the same height as the linemen - and I think they look great. However, like with all good things, GW has now ruined them by retracting their metal versions and replacing them with Failcasts. Shouldn't be to hard to find on eBay, though.

Yeah as already mentioned above the GW WFB Witch Elves dont look too out of place with the 2nd Ed Dark Elf Team. The WFB Witch elves are slightly smaller than the 3rd Ed Blood bowl counterparts.

Also Reaper minis do some cool female figs that would work with a bit of cutting and green stuff. I think the dark heaven range is slightly smaller than the heroic 28/32mm scale too.
